Bill Summary
For legislation to allow election day registration. Election Laws.
AI Summary
This bill allows for election day registration in Massachusetts. It amends the state's election laws to permit any person who has not previously registered to vote to appear before the registrars of the city or town of their legal residence on the day of an election and register as a voter. The registrant must complete an affidavit of voter registration, present suitable identification, and be permitted to vote at that election if the registrars determine they are qualified. The state secretary is required to promulgate regulations to implement this new election day registration provision, which will take effect on January 1, 2021.
